401 Heavy Duty Truck Parts Inc. Joins VIPAR Heavy Duty Network
VIPAR Heavy Duty is pleased to announce that 401 Heavy Duty Truck Parts Inc., headquartered in Mississauga, Ontario, has joined the VIPAR Heavy Duty network of independent distributors, adding five locations to the organization’s network in Canada.
Founded in 2017, 401 Heavy Duty Truck Parts Inc. is a full-line heavy duty aftermarket distributor serving customers throughout the Toronto Area. It was started by Abdul Mian and David Langley with a vision to deliver a strong customer-focused approach to truck and trailer parts distribution.
“We set out to build a business centered around accessibility and customer support with things like extended hours (all stores are open 7 days a week, 364 days a year) and hiring former truck mechanics to work on our counters. Most importantly, we listened to our customers and our valued vendors to ensure that we have the parts that they need when they need them,” said Langley.
401 Heavy Duty Truck Parts Inc. is led by Mian, Owner, their CFO Sofia Mian, their Vice President Umayr Mian, and Langley, Director of Sales and Marketing, who is a veteran of the heavy duty aftermarket with more than 30 years of industry experience. The organization employs approximately 40 team members and operates a fleet of delivery vehicles to support regional customers.
The company has grown from a single location into a multi-branch operation with facilities in Mississauga, Cambridge, London, Bolton, and Brampton, Ontario, supporting fleets, diesel and trailer repair shops, and government accounts across Canada’s largest trucking market.
At its headquarters in Mississauga, 401 Heavy Duty Truck Parts Inc. operates alongside ASA Truck Repairs (also owned by Mian) at the same facility. This integrated model allows drivers and fleets to source parts and complete repairs or preventative maintenance efficiently at a single location.
The company offers a comprehensive inventory with over 9,000 different parts in stock, including air and brake products, filters, cooling, lubricants, truck lighting, accessories, and specialized products such as wiring harnesses, NOx sensors, and DEF filters. Complementing its in-store inventory, 401 Heavy Duty Truck Parts Inc. provides delivery services for larger parts orders and maintains an experienced team of parts professionals to support customers. All locations offer flywheel resurfacing or exchange.
“With their presence in the Toronto market and commitment to customer service, 401 Heavy Duty Truck Parts Inc. is a good addition to the VIPAR Heavy Duty network,” said Joe Meyer, VIPAR Heavy Duty Vice President of Business Development. “Their integrated parts and service approach and continued investment in growth align well with our focus on supporting independent distributors and their customers in Canada.”
“As a company with an aggressive growth plan, the next logical step for us was to join a buying group. After looking at all of the available options, VIPAR Heavy Duty stood above all others with their vast supplier network and the support that they offered to their independent distributors. We are looking forward to building our business through them and their valued supplier partners,” said Langley.
VIPAR Heavy Duty Awards Strategic Partner Designation to Truck-Lite and ECCO
VIPAR Heavy Duty has recognized Truck-Lite and ECCO as its latest suppliers to earn the VIPAR Heavy Duty Strategic Partner (VSP) designation. The two companies, both part of Clarience Technologies, join an elite group of suppliers that demonstrate a strong commitment to supporting the organization’s distributors, fleets, and strategic initiatives across the heavy-duty aftermarket.
“Truck-Lite and ECCO bring exceptional value to our distributor network through their commitment to innovation, safety, and service,” said Larry Griffin, VIPAR Heavy Duty Vice President of Program Management. “Their strong support of fleets, investment in data quality, and product offerings that extend across key international markets align closely with our strategic priorities. We are pleased to welcome them as Strategic Partners.”
Truck-Lite and ECCO earned the designation by meeting key criteria established by VIPAR Heavy Duty, including active support of fleets through the organization’s National Accounts Program, meaningful contribution of product content to PARTSPHERE PIM®, VIPAR Heavy Duty’s Product Information Management system, and delivering comprehensive product programs that serve both VIPAR Heavy Duty and Power Heavy Duty distributors.
“We are honored that Truck-Lite and ECCO have been recognized as VIPAR Heavy Duty Strategic Partners,” said Brian Olsen, EVP and President, Visibility Solutions, Clarience Technologies. “This designation reflects our shared commitment to supporting distributors and fleets with innovative, high-quality solutions. We value our partnership and look forward to continued collaboration to deliver value across the heavy-duty aftermarket.”
Suppliers that earn the VSP designation benefit from enhanced visibility and engagement opportunities, including special recognition and priority positioning at the IMPACT Conference, expanded branding across distributor touchpoints, and increased networking and collaboration with the VIPAR Heavy Duty Family of Companies team and distributor members.
Truck-Lite and ECCO join the VSP group alongside Baldwin Filters, Donaldson Company, East Penn, Grote, Prestone, Tectran, and Tramec.
About Truck-Lite
Truck-Lite Co., LLC, a Clarience Technologies company, is a global technology leader focused on forward and safety lighting, wiring harnesses, turn signals and safety accessories for the medium- and heavy-duty truck, trailer, off-road and commercial vehicle industries. The company is headquartered in Erie, Pa., with additional U.S. facilities in Coudersport, McElhattan and Wellsboro, Pa. and international facilities in Harlow, England and Puebla, Mexico. About ECCO
ECCO, a Clarience Technologies company, is a global leader in safety and warning equipment for commercial vehicles, serving aftermarket customers across industries such as construction, towing, utilities, mining, municipalities, and emergency services. Having invented the back-up alarm, ECCO is known for their focus on safety and depth in product offering, providing products designed to enhance visibility and reduce risk in demanding work environments.
ECCO’s extensive product portfolio includes beacons, minibars, lightbars, directional warning lights, worklights, back-up alarms, and rear-view camera systems. Diesel USA Group Brings Turbocharger Expertise to the VIPAR Heavy Duty Distributor Network
Diesel USA Group Inc., a long established leader in diesel engine products and services, has joined VIPAR Heavy Duty, bringing seven additional U.S. locations to the network.
Diesel USA Group provides a comprehensive portfolio of diesel engine products, including turbochargers, fuel systems, exhaust and emission components, electrical parts, filtration products, and charged air products. The company also offers high value technical services, such as machining, diagnostics, DPF cleaning, component repair, remanufacturing, and full service parts distribution.
Founded in 1950 by World War II veteran Lloyd A. Bailey, Diesel USA Group began as Diesel Injection Service Company in Louisville, Kentucky. Bailey’s technical expertise and early involvement in the post war diesel service industry — including his participation in the first meeting of the Association of Diesel Specialists (ADS) in 1956 — helped shape the company’s trajectory and the industry at large.
In 2019, Diesel USA Group was acquired by JASPER Holdings, Inc., parent company of Jasper Engines & Transmissions. The company continues to operate as an independent brand within JASPER’s ESOP structure while retaining the leadership team that has guided its long term growth.
Jerry Mabis, Corporate Liaison at JASPER Holdings Inc., explained that Diesel USA joined VIPAR Heavy Duty to leverage its long‑standing position as a central distributor of fuel‑injection, turbocharger, and engine‑related fuel‑system component product lines.
"In evaluating the opportunity, we recognized the value‑added benefits of aligning with VIPAR Heavy Duty’s established network and expanding access to complementary product lines. As we looked at our existing relationships with leading suppliers within the VIPAR Heavy Duty family, it became clear that joining as a stockholder would deliver significant mutual benefit," said Mabis.
Diesel USA Group serves a diverse customer base across industries that rely on gas and diesel engine systems. Its market reach extends nationwide through locations in Louisville, Ky.; Cincinnati and Columbus, Ohio; Indianapolis, Fort Wayne, and Crown Point, Ind.; and Fontana, Calif. These facilities enable the company to deliver fast, reliable products and technical expertise to commercial fleets, consumer diesel drivers, and equipment owners demanding trusted performance and support.
“Diesel USA Group’s decades long commitment to technical excellence, deep industry expertise, and strategically located facilities significantly strengthen our network’s ability to support customers nationwide. By adding their proven capabilities in diesel engine products, diagnostics, and remanufacturing, we are expanding both the depth and reach of the solutions we can offer to end-users,” said Joe Meyer, Vice President of Business Development for VIPAR Heavy Duty.
